The best mesothelioma lawyers are licensed in multiple states. They will have years of experience working with each state's legal system and will be able to determine the most appropriate jurisdiction to file your case.

Additionally, these firms are familiar with local mesothelioma law and the statutes of limitations. This will enable them to file your lawsuit within the prescribed time frame to ensure that you have a good chance of recovering compensation.

In New York, asbestos claims are limited to three years after diagnosis in personal injury cases and two years after death in cases of wrongful death. Mesothelioma symptoms and lung cancer can take a long time to develop so it is crucial that you consult a lawyer as soon as you can.

The statutes of limitation in each state define the time frame an individual has to submit a claim to compensation. If the statute of limitation expires, you won't be able to seek compensation for your injuries or illnesses.

A top mesothelioma law firm will understand the different statutes of limitation and how they are applicable to specific circumstances. They will make sure your case is filed by the deadline. They can also help you look into other options for compensation, such as trust fund claims.

The time limit for asbestos lawsuits is based on many factors. For instance, the type of claim will affect when the clock starts to tick. This applies to personal injury as well as cases of wrongful death. The location of your lawsuit may also impact the statute of limitations. This could be due to the place of your exposure, where you reside now, or where the asbestos company is located.

Mesothelioma has an extended latency time, meaning it can take decades for symptoms to manifest and a diagnosis to be established. In contrast to most personal injury lawsuits, asbestos litigation involves a complex web of regulations and laws. A skilled New York mesothelioma attorney has the knowledge and experience to collect and organize the data necessary to win a case. They begin by looking over your work history, noting the types of jobs you held and specific machinery you used at each site. They will also check to find out if any relatives or co-workers who were employed at the same site could provide witnesses.

Once they know the types of industries you worked in The New York mesothelioma lawyer will determine which companies are accountable for exposing you asbestos. They will also look into any successor firms to determine their responsibility. Many asbestos victims have been exposed to more than one asbestos company and a lot of them went out of business without their liabilities being fully resolved.
